Forms Clock Remains Open
Comments on the FDIC’s proposed weekly and quarterly reporting forms for FDIC-supervised permitted payment stablecoin issuers are due Thursday, September 18, 2026 under OMB 3064-0225. The Federal Register notice published July 20 lists the forms as PS-01 for larger issuers, the short-form PS-01a for smaller ones, and PS-02 for quarterly data. This Paperwork Reduction Act process stands separate from the closed AG19 prudential rulemaking and the closed AG29 BSA comment period.
